CocoaPods福利时间

以下是我平时使用经常用到的Podfile会用到的一些写法。

福利一

首先是有一些库编译时候会有警告。但是作为一个有洁癖的人呢不想看见这些

可以在platform :ios, ‘x.0’的后面加入这句

      
      
      
      
1
      
      
      
      
inhibit_all_warnings !

这样编译这些第三方库的时候就没有那些烦人的小警告了。

福利二

使用福利一是不是很爽呢。但是有一个神库ReactiveCocoa。当你关闭所有警告的时候。它就编译不过了。可急坏了。其实很简单对他单独设置打开编译警告就好了

      
      
      
      
1
      
      
      
      
pod 'ReactiveCocoa', '~> 2.1.8', :inhibit_warnings => true

福利三

如果你有多个Targets需要pod的库怎么办
也很简单。Podfile的头部加入

      
      
      
      
1
      
      
      
      
link_with [ 'AAAAA', 'BBBBB']

AAAAA和BBBBB都是你target的名字,这样不同的target都会有pod库了。我主要是用来解决Unit Test需要pod install一些库的问题。当初也是找了老半天才找到。

总结

CocoaPods很好用。而且一直在进化。我发现我怎么写介绍都只停留在很浅显的基础上。更多更深入的内容需要自己使用了。然后慢慢积累的。总之。不用CocoaPods的Cocoa开发太Out了。

你可能感兴趣的:(CocoaPods福利时间)